Guy-
Hey there! As promised, I revised my patch to allow both a user to press ctrl-c in a window or send a SIGINT to ethereal to stop an in-progress trace. I assumed since I didn't hear back from you that SIGINT was the most appropriate signal to use here (as opposed to SIGUSR2). Anywho, let me know what you think. Thanks!
Neil
